  • Calculating radius is a relatively simple process that involves understanding a few basic concepts. In essence, the radius of a circle is the distance from its center to any point on the circle's circumference. To calculate the radius of a circle, you need to know its diameter, circumference, or area. Here are the formulas to calculate radius:

    Using these formulas, you can easily calculate the radius of a circle using a variety of input values.

    In the United States, calculating radius is gaining attention due to its widespread applications in various fields, such as architecture, engineering, and geography. With the increasing focus on sustainability and green architecture, accurately calculating radii is essential for designing energy-efficient buildings and infrastructure. Additionally, the rise of online mapping and geographic information systems (GIS) has highlighted the importance of accurate radius calculations in urban planning and navigation.
